PITTSBURGH -- Coming off a devastating touchdown reversal against his Steelers, coach Mike Tomlin predicts intense offseason discussion over the NFL's catch rule.
Tomlin, who's on the league's competition committee, saw officials override tight end Jesse James' 10-yard touchdown catch against the New England Patriots with 28 seconds left because he didn't "survive the ground." The Patriots held on to win 27-24 after Ben Roethlisberger threw an interception with 5 seconds left.
"I think that we all can acknowledge that all of this needs to be revisited," Tomlin said.
